Downtime and risky releases are a constant threat for Rails-based products: a single bad migration, slow dependency, or misconfigured environment can cause customer-facing errors, rollback fatigue, and lost revenue. Teams often rely on manual steps—provisioning, switching traffic, warming caches, and validating health checks—leading to inconsistent outcomes across environments.
DevionixLabs automates blue-green deployments for Rails so you can release with confidence while keeping production stable. We design a repeatable pipeline that provisions a “green” environment alongside “blue,” deploys your Rails application and assets, runs targeted health checks, and only then switches traffic using controlled routing. If validation fails, traffic remains on the “blue” environment and the “green” stack can be corrected without disrupting users.
What we deliver:
• Blue-green deployment workflow integrated with your CI/CD (build, deploy, validate, switch)
• Rails-aware health checks (app readiness, database connectivity, background job liveness) to prevent premature traffic shifts
• Traffic switching strategy with safe rollback behavior and clear release status signals
• Environment parity controls to reduce “works in staging” failures (config, secrets handling, asset compilation)
• Deployment observability hooks (release markers, logs/metrics correlation, and post-switch validation)
We also help your team operationalize the process with runbooks and guardrails: release criteria, automated gating rules, and a documented rollback path. The result is a deployment system that behaves the same way every time—across staging and production—so engineering can ship faster without trading away reliability.
BEFORE vs AFTER DEVIONIXLABS:
BEFORE DEVIONIXLABS:
✗ manual traffic switching that increases human error
✗ slow rollback decisions during incident response
✗ inconsistent health validation across environments
✗ deployments that occasionally expose users to partial failures
✗ release confidence gaps that delay shipping
AFTER DEVIONIXLABS:
✓ automated blue-green releases with deterministic traffic switching
✓ faster rollback with traffic staying on the last known-good stack
✓ consistent Rails readiness checks before traffic is routed
✓ reduced customer impact by preventing premature cutovers
✓ measurable improvement in release frequency and deployment success rate
Join 5,000+ organizations transforming their infrastructure with DevionixLabs!
Free 30-minute consultation for your Fintech and B2B SaaS platforms running Ruby on Rails with high availability requirements infrastructure. No credit card, no commitment.